Fiuu, a leading fintech platform in Southeast Asia, has announced a partnership with Pos Malaysia, the national post and parcel service provider, and Payments Network Malaysia Sdn Bhd (PayNet), the national payments network, to introduce a cashless solution for cash-on-delivery (COD) payments.
Powered by Fiuu’s payment platform and PayNet’s DuitNow QR, the initiative aims to make COD transactions more seamless and secure for Malaysians, offering a modern payment experience at their doorstep.
Customers can now pay for parcels by scanning a QR code on their smartphones — eliminating the need for cash and reducing delays during delivery. This new feature not only enhances customer convenience but also supports the nation’s transition toward a cashless economy.
Revolutionising Cash-On-Delivery Across Malaysia
DuitNow QR, Malaysia’s national QR standard developed by PayNet, simplifies digital payments for consumers and businesses alike. With this rollout, over 6,000 Pos Malaysia riders across Peninsular Malaysia, Sabah, and Sarawak are now equipped to collect COD payments digitally.
This improvement tackles long-standing operational challenges such as manual cash handling, shortage of small change, and theft or misplacement of funds, making COD safer for both customers and delivery riders.
The solution also supports cross-border e-wallet and mobile banking payments, including Alipay+, Weixin Pay (WeChat Pay), UnionPay QR, QRIS, NETS, and PromptPay. This allows non-Malaysian customers to make payments conveniently, while merchants enjoy domestic transaction rates — expanding reach without additional cost.
Strengthening Malaysia’s Parcel And Payments Ecosystem
With over 30 million parcels delivered annually, Pos Malaysia’s adoption of DuitNow QR represents a major step forward in modernising parcel and payment systems. By integrating Fiuu’s platform, the partnership improves payment efficiency, reduces risks, and supports e-commerce growth nationwide.
For consumers, the system offers speed, convenience, and security. For merchants, it helps cut operational costs, reduce reconciliation issues, and streamline payment management.
